2013-09-21 7 views
6

I ActionBarSherlock Seitenmenü Navigationsleiste in meiner Anwendung zu implementieren ist versucht, aber immer bekommen:DrawerLayout und ActionBarDrawerToggle können nicht auf eine Art gelöst werden

DrawerLayout kann nicht auf einen Typ ActionBarDrawerToggle aufgelöst werden kann nicht aufgelöst werden eine Art

Meine Importe sind:

import android.content.res.Configuration; 
import android.os.Bundle; 
import android.support.v4.app.Fragment; 
import android.support.v4.app.FragmentTransaction; 
import android.view.View; 
import android.widget.AdapterView; 
import android.widget.ListView; 

import com.actionbarsherlock.app.SherlockFragmentActivity; 
import com.actionbarsherlock.view.MenuItem; 
+0

Check out this link. Hoffe das wird dir helfen. http://stackoverflow.com/questions/17046443/android-import-drawerlayout-cannot-be-resolved – khubaib

Antwort

8

Import diese von der Support-Bibliothek

import android.support.v4.app.ActionBarDrawerToggle; 
import android.support.v4.widget.DrawerLayout; 

prüfen diese

http://developer.android.com/tools/support-library/index.html

Für weitere Informationen über NaigationDrawer

http://developer.android.com/training/implementing-navigation/nav-drawer.html

+1

Ich denke, es ist wichtig zu fügen, dass Sie die v4-Support-Bibliothek verwenden können, oder Sie können einfach kopieren Sie die 'android-support- v13.jar' unterstützt die Bibliothek im Ordner/libs Ihres Projekts. – Brandon

2

ja ich mit @Raghunandan voll zustimmen, wenn wir tun Wenn Sie mit Navigation Drawer arbeiten, müssen Sie Latest support Library verwenden

Und wenn wir mit ActionBar Sherlock Navigationsleiste arbeiten, einige Importe wir in unserem Programm verwenden müssen, siehe unten:

import android.support.v4.app.ActionBarDrawerToggle; 
import android.support.v4.widget.DrawerLayout; 
import android.support.v4.view.GravityCompat; 
import com.actionbarsherlock.app.SherlockFragmentActivity; 
import com.actionbarsherlock.view.MenuItem; 
Verwandte Themen